1. Install "codeblocks-common" package

Here is a brief guide to show you how to install codeblocks-common on Kali Linux

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install codeblocks-common

2. Uninstall "codeblocks-common" package

Please follow the guidelines below to uninstall codeblocks-common on Kali Linux:

$ sudo apt remove codeblocks-common $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ove

Description: common files for Code::Blocks IDE
Code::Blocks is a cross-platform Integrated Development Environment (IDE).
It is based on a self-developed plugin framework allowing unlimited
extensibility. Most of its functionality is already provided by plugins.
.
This package contains the architecture-independent files of Code::Blocks.
